ASSEMBLY
UNPACKING
•
Remove all parts from the packaging.
•
Remove all packaging materials and any
transport protection.
•
Check that no parts are missing.
•
Inspect the product and accessories for
damage.
•
If possible save the packaging until the
warranty has expired.
NOTE:
Do not allow children to play with the
packaging material. Keep plastic bags, plastic
film and small parts out of the reach of
children – risk of suffocation.

ASSEMBLY OF THE LAWN MOWER
1.
Unpack the product and all the
accessories and check that all the parts
are included.
2.
Fit the bottom handle on the product with
a quick-coupling (c) on each side.
FIG. 2
FIG. 3
3.
Fit the top handle with a screw (a), a
washer (b) and a quick-coupling (c) on
each side. Make sure that the cords, which
are connected later, are not in the way.
FIG. 4
FIG. 5
4.
Fit the cords on the handle with the clips
(7).
FIG. 6
5.
Open the grass catcher (4) and press the
plastic clips on the frame.
FIG. 7
6.
Lift up the ejector flap (3) with one hand
and hook on the grass catcher (4).
FIG. 8
INSERTING THE BATTERY
Open the battery compartment (6). Put the
battery in the holder.
